From 9fd605a40768606181dbeb16f5a1c1480d7fae76 Mon Sep 17 00:00:00 2001 From: Vishesh Handa Date: Mon, 21 Dec 2020 12:11:48 +0100 Subject: [PATCH] Add some extra debugging for the Android External Storage --- lib/screens/settings_screen.dart |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/lib/screens/settings_screen.dart b/lib/screens/settings_screen.dart index 66748ab3..0c668c76 100644 --- a/lib/screens/settings_screen.dart +++ b/lib/screens/settings_screen.dart @@ -11,6 +11,7 @@ import 'package:path/path.dart' as p; import 'package:permission_handler/permission_handler.dart'; import 'package:provider/provider.dart'; import 'package:url_launcher/url_launcher.dart'; +import 'package:path_provider/path_provider.dart'; import 'package:gitjournal/app_settings.dart'; import 'package:gitjournal/core/notes_folder_fs.dart'; @@ -314,6 +315,11 @@ class SettingsListState extends State { settings.storeInternally = true; var path = await ExtStorage.getExternalStorageDirectory(); + Log.i("Got ExternalStorageDirectory: $path"); + + var extDir = await getExternalStorageDirectory(); + Log.i("Ext Dir: $extDir"); + if (path == null || path.isEmpty) { settings.storeInternally = true; settings.storageLocation = "";